Nestled within Amsterdam’s Vondelpark, the Schapenweide Installation offers a unique charm. The Schapenweide, meaning “sheep meadow,” lives up to its name with stone sheep sculptures scattered across the area. These sheep, installed in 2016 by Van Swieten Kunstobjecten, add a touch of whimsy to this tranquil spot. The Schapenweide has a rich history, once a grazing ground for actual sheep and cows. It was part of the last section of the Vondelpark, designed by Louis Paul Zocher and added between 1874 and 1878. The area was meant to evoke a rural atmosphere. A nearby farmhouse even provided fresh milk from cows grazed in the park. For years, a stork has called the Schapenweide home, its nest a prominent feature. A beehive, managed by Smart Beeing, also resides here, promoting biological beekeeping and offering educational opportunities. While the Schapenweide may no longer host live sheep, the stone sculptures serve as a charming reminder of its pastoral past. They invite visitors to reflect on the park’s history and appreciate its evolving landscape.
